New name UI_UPDATE for interpret_move's return "".
Now midend.c directly tests the returned pointer for equality to this value, instead of checking whether it's the empty string. A minor effect of this is that games may now return a dynamically allocated empty string from interpret_move() and treat it as just another legal move description. But I don't expect anyone to be perverse enough to actually do that! The main purpose is that it avoids returning a string literal from a function whose return type is a pointer to _non-const_ char, i.e. we are now one step closer to being able to make this code base clean under -Wwrite-strings.
